| Debt | Debt Revolving Credit Facility On May 8, 2026, the Company entered into a new $25.0 million revolving credit agreement with Fifth Third Bank, National Association (the “new revolving credit facility”) and terminated its prior revolving credit facility, dated October 16, 2023, as amended (the “prior revolving credit facility”). The new revolving credit facility matures on May 8, 2029 and may be increased to up to $50.0 million at the Company’s request, subject to the lender’s sole discretion. Borrowings bear interest at one-month Term SOFR plus 1.50% per annum, and the Company pays a 0.20% per annum fee on the unused commitments. The facility is secured by a first-priority lien on cash and investment securities held in a collateral account maintained with the lender, the value of which, after applying specified advance rates, must equal at least 100% of outstanding borrowings and letter of credit obligations. The new revolving credit facility is not guaranteed by the Company’s subsidiaries and does not contain a financial maintenance covenant based on the Company’s operating results or any restriction on the payment of dividends or the repurchase of the Company’s common stock. In connection with the termination of the prior revolving credit facility, the Company wrote off $1.2 million of unamortized debt issuance costs during the three months ended June 30, 2026. At June 30, 2026, the new revolving credit facility was undrawn and there was $20.0 million of borrowing capacity under the facility, after giving effect to $5.0 million of outstanding letters of credit deemed issued thereunder. At December 31, 2025, the prior revolving credit facility was undrawn and there was $36.7 million of borrowing capacity under that facility, after giving effect to $5.0 million of outstanding letters of credit. The Company was in compliance with all covenants under the new revolving credit facility at June 30, 2026.
